Transaction 2389495c1691af7b08acf51ca4ff9341e50eeb5926bff46df63a8a6e2537df61

3 Input
2 Outputs
  • 2389495c1691af7b08acf51ca4ff9341e50eeb5926bff46df63a8a6e2537df61:0
  • value  1765092
    address  3Pxmz5rQ9AnCYY5FXbdCwbM41VvqPMZb5L
  • 2389495c1691af7b08acf51ca4ff9341e50eeb5926bff46df63a8a6e2537df61:1
  • value  23796
    address  38troTHwrtjmJXUd2JcYibP9zKnAqDT5Es